Familiarize yourself with local fishing rules to ensure a legal and sustainable catch.
Weather can change rapidly; bring layers to stay comfortable throughout the day.
Mosquitoes and flies can be persistent during the summer months, so be prepared.
Early mornings often provide the best fishing conditions and fewer crowds.
Miller’s Landing has a rich history as a key part of Seward’s fishing and tourism industry, dating back to the early 20th century.
The area promotes sustainable fishing practices and habitat preservation to ensure future generations can enjoy this pristine environment.
